Jocelyn Green’s 2022 release, Drawn by the Current, is a story that invokes empathy while piquing curiosity and deeply rooting readers in 1915 Chicago. The Eastland Boat disaster was one that never should have happened. Jocelyn Green brings readers into a fictional story that brings all the emotions of the past to surface.

What was to be a birthday celebration, turns deadly for insurance agent, Olive Pierce. She barely escapes the capsizing of the SS Eastland, and learns that her best friend is among the victims of the disaster. Tasked to pay out the claims to family of victims, Olive searches out the truth of the whereabouts of those missing.

This story deals with some pretty hard issues – domestic violence, death, and protecting loved ones at all costs. There is a sensitivity the author displays to the raw reality that many live with on a daily basis. Despite this being a historical novel, it is a relevant story for modern times.

On a lighter note, there are delightful twists and connections that readers may not see coming.  

And if you’re not into romance, this is a perfect read. There isn’t much of it at all.
